I tried following instructions from here http://www.cyberciti.biz/faq/debian-redhat-ubuntu-linux-install-lo_3-3-0-linux_x86_install-rpm_en-us-tar-gz/ Made a directory at an arbitary location /usr/local/src/ /usr/local/src/libreoffice/$ Downloaded both the packages LibO_3.3.0rc3_Linux_x86-64_helppack-deb_en-US.tar.gz LibO_3.3.0rc3_Linux_x86-64_install-deb_en-US.tar.gz Extracted both in different directories tar xzvf *.gz then went to individual directories and installed them. cd LibO_3.3.0rc3_Linux_x86-64_helppack-deb_en-US/DEBS/ sudo dpkg -i *.deb There were couple of core files which didn't get installed the first time around, installed them again and it went without an hitch. Then when trying to install the helppack get the following error /usr/local/src/libreoffice/LibO_3.3.0rc3_Linux_x86-64_helppack-deb_en-US/DEBS$ sudo dpkg -i libobasis3.3-en-us-help_3.3.0-19_amd64.deb [sudo] password for shirish: (Reading database ... 227392 files and directories currently installed.) Preparing to replace libobasis3.3-en-us-help 3.3.0-17 (using libobasis3.3-en-us-help_3.3.0-19_amd64.deb) ... Unpacking replacement libobasis3.3-en-us-help ... dpkg: error processing libobasis3.3-en-us-help_3.3.0-19_amd64.deb (--install): trying to overwrite '/opt/libreoffice/basis3.3/help/en/simpress.key', which is also in package libobasis3.3-en-us-impress 3.3.0-17 dpkg-deb: subprocess paste killed by signal (Broken pipe) Errors were encountered while processing: libobasis3.3-en-us-help_3.3.0-19_amd64.deb Please let me know if I'm doing something wrong.

If you're not particularly interested in pre-release versions, you can just use the Debian Apt repo and try this : apt-cache search libreoffice|grep help to find helppack in your language.
By re reading the logs in your first comment, I wonder if you had removed every element of a previous install. Eg, we can see 2 versions of this line dpkg: error processing libobasis3.3-en-us-help_3.3.0-19_amd64.deb (--install): trying to overwrite '/opt/libreoffice/basis3.3/help/en/simpress.key', which is also in package libobasis3.3-en-us-impress 3.3.0-17
